What companies run services between Porta, Catalonia, Spain and Seville, Spain?

Vueling Airlines, Ryanair, and Iberia fly from Barcelona–El Prat Airport (BCN) to Seville Airport (SVQ) every 3 hours. Alternatively, iryo operates a train from Barcelona-Sants to Sevilla-Santa Justa twice daily. Tickets cost €35–140 and the journey takes 6h 3m. Two other operators also service this route.
